First of all I congratulate you in recognizing your own weakness and your desire for changing yourself.
That is the first step towards building a strong mind.
Please understand, worrying will not solve any problems. As long as your mind dwells in a problem it gets worse. The moment your mind shifts to a solution oriented attitude you will feel more confident.
Let me suggest the following to you:
1. List out the present problems one by one in a paper on the left side and write down the possble solutions on the right side. You will wonder that your own mind can find solutions too.
2. Categorize them into temporary and long term problems. Describe it as if they are all going to be solved very well.
3. Do not hesitate to seek help from your well wishers and thank them from your heart instead of feeling miserable for any obligations.
4. Visualize yourself and others being very hapy and peaceful, just before retiring to sleep and immediatley after waking up.
5. Doing Yoga and meditation will help you develop mental strength.
Please chant Lalithasahasranamam regularly. It is good to chant it sitting near the sick person or touching him. The aura it creates helps healing and also provides strength. Hari Om.
